Terrain-Adaptive Engineering for Complex Mobility Routes
Geographical diversity across the region demands mobility systems capable of adapting to steep gradients, shifting soils, and climate variations. Terrain-adaptive engineering models assess stability requirements, alignment feasibility, and material specifications to ensure consistent performance. These analyses help reduce operational risk, extend asset lifecycle, and maintain uninterrupted flows across long-haul networks. Intermodal Linkages for Extended Supply Chain Reach
Long-haul systems increasingly integrate with ports, airports, rail terminals, and overland border platforms. Mobility planners evaluate how long-distance connections reinforce cargo throughput and how intermodal synchrony supports export competitiveness. These linkages help consolidate supply chain continuity from inland production centers to international gateways. As Latin America intensifies trade-oriented modernization, interoperable mobility solutions become essential components of long-range logistics strategies.
